
Gaza [Palestine], August 20 (ANI/WAM): The United Arab Emirates has continued its humanitarian support for the Palestinian people in the Gaza Strip, carrying out its 75th airdrop of aid under the Birds of Goodness initiative, part of Operation Chivalrous Knight 3. The effort was conducted in cooperation with the Hashemite Kingdom of Jordan, with the participation of Germany, Italy, France, the Netherlands, Singapore and Indonesia.
The shipment included essential food supplies prepared with the support of Emirati charitable institutions and organizations, aimed at meeting the urgent needs of Gaza’s population amid dire humanitarian conditions.
With the completion of this airdrop, the total aid delivered by air under the operation has surpassed 4,012 tonnes of food and other critical supplies.
